Job Description
We are currently looking for a Data Architect to join our forward-thinking Data department. You’ll work in a team of data engineers, analytics engineers, data scientists and AI specialists to design and evolve scalable data platforms and modern data products that enable self-service analytics, advanced modelling, and AI-driven decision-making across our insurance business.
What you’ll do:
- Design and manage scalable cloud data platforms (Databricks on AWS) across development, staging, and production environments, ensuring reliable performance and cost efficiency.
- Integrate and model data from diverse sources – including warehouses, APIs, marketing platforms, and operational systems – using DBT, Delta Live Tables, and dimensional modelling to deliver consistent, trusted analytics.
- Enable advanced AI and ML use cases by building pipelines for vector search, retrieval-augmented generation (RAG), feature engineering, and model deployment.
- Ensure security and governance through robust access controls, including RBAC, SSO, token policies, and pseudonymisation frameworks.
- Develop resilient data flows for both batch and streaming workloads using technologies such as Kafka, Airflow, DBT, and Terraform.
- Shape data strategy and standards by contributing to architectural decisions, authoring ADRs, and participating in reviews, data councils, and platform enablement initiatives.
Qualifications
What we’d love you to bring:
- Proven, hands-on expertise in data modelling, with a strong track record of designing and implementing complex dimensional models, star and snowflake schemas, and enterprise-wide canonical data models
- Proficiency in converting intricate insurance business processes into scalable and user-friendly data structures that drive analytics, reporting, and scenarios powered by technology
- Extensive experience designing fact and dimension tables across domains such as policy, quote, claims, pricing, and fraud, ensuring consistency and alignment with business metrics
- Deep practical knowledge of semantic layer design and implementation using DBT, SQL, and Delta Live Tables
- Strong background in building high-performance, scalable data models that support self-service BI and regulatory reporting requirements
- Direct exposure to cloud-native data infrastructures (Databricks, Snowflake) especially in AWS environments is a plus
- Experience in building and maintaining batch and streaming data pipelines using Kafka, Airflow, or Spark
- Familiarity with governance frameworks, access controls (RBAC), and implementation of pseudonymisation and retention policies
- Exposure to enabling GenAI and ML workloads by preparing model-ready and vector-optimised datasets
- Demonstrated capability to collaborate successfully with interested parties in data engineering, analytics, architecture, and business teams
- Advanced SQL skills and a keen focus on performance tuning, data integrity, and reusable compose patterns across data products

How to prepare for a job interview at Women in Data®
✨Know Your Data Models
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of data modelling techniques, especially star and snowflake schemas. Be ready to discuss how you've designed and implemented complex models in the past, as this will show your hands-on expertise.
✨Familiarise with Cloud Technologies
Since the role involves working with Databricks on AWS, it’s crucial to understand cloud-native data infrastructures. Prepare to talk about your experience with these technologies and how you've leveraged them for scalable data solutions.
✨Showcase Your Problem-Solving Skills
Be prepared to discuss specific examples where you've integrated diverse data sources or built resilient data flows. Highlight your ability to tackle challenges in data architecture and how your solutions have driven analytics and reporting.
✨Understand Security and Governance
Security is key in data management. Familiarise yourself with access controls like RBAC and pseudonymisation frameworks. Be ready to explain how you've implemented these in previous roles to ensure data integrity and compliance.
